A FIPA agent platform is defined as software that implements the set of FIPA specifications. To be considered FIPA-compliant, an agent platform implementation must at least implement the Agent Management and Agent Communication Language specifications.

The following is a list of FIPA-compliant networks which are publicly available for use:

  • Agentcities is an initiative to create a next generation Internet that is based upon a worldwide network of services that use the metaphor of a real or a virtual city to cluster services.
  • FIPA-NET was an early attempt to create a test bed of multiple inter-linked FIPA agent platforms, whose activities are now continued in Agentcities.
